Analysis
In 2018, vaccinations (bcg) (% of children ages 12-23 months): q2 in Mongolia stood at 98.8%.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, vaccinations (bcg) (% of children ages 12-23 months): q2 in Mongolia peaked at 100.0% in 2014 and was at its lowest, 97.0%, in 2000.
Mongolia ranks 5th of 42 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

About this data
Vaccinations: Percentage of children 12-23 months who have received specific vaccines by the time of the survey (according to the vaccination card or the mother's report). Children with all vaccinations refer children who have received BCG, measles, and three doses each of DPT and polio vaccine (excluding polio 0). Some MICS surveys refer children in different age groups (e.g. 18-29 months, or 15-26 months).
